Transaction ef3310260b8eda3bb054d607743c42b265ec9c024252db01e13c13532c1561ac
1 Input
1 Output
-
ef3310260b8eda3bb054d607743c42b265ec9c024252db01e13c13532c1561ac:0
- value
- 51430
- script pubkey
- OP_0 OP_PUSHBYTES_20 ea5bc7c7a273183c1544895690d4f6f43ba9609a
- address
- bc1qafdu03azwvvrc92y39tfp48k7sa6jcy6wd5cxa